WebIf other causes for urinary incontinence are ruled out and your pet is diagnosed with USMI, than your vet may recommend a medication called Proin which contains phenylpropanolamine (PPA). 3 At the time of this writing, this medication is the most common drug used to treat hormonal incontinence in spayed female dogs. WebProin is a prescription medication for veterinary use in dogs. Proin is available as 25mg, 50mg and 75mg chewable, liver flavor tablets. WebUrinary incontinence can occur after spay of the female dog and the onset of signs can vary from immediately to 10 years after surgery. Leaking urine while asleep appears to be the most common complaint. Urinary incontinence can be daily or episodic and range from mild to very severe. It is usually caused by a medical condition, and your … black tree stumpWebAug 29, 2012 · Another course of treatment is phenylpropanolamine (PPA), which is a nonhormonal medication that directly stimulates closure receptors in the urethra. About 85 to 90 percent of spayed female dogs will show an excellent response to PPA.
